MI SB0111
Bill
AI Summary
-
Amends the Michigan Renaissance Zone Act to add definitions for entrepreneurial businesses, entrepreneurial business facilities, border crossing facilities, eligible Next Michigan businesses, and multimodal commerce.
-
Authorizes the Michigan Strategic Fund board to designate additional renaissance zones for entrepreneurial business facilities within cities, villages, or townships that consent, with a 5-year duration for each zone.
-
Requires renaissance zones for entrepreneurial businesses to be one continuous geographic area and allows the board to revoke designation if the facility fails to commence operation, ceases operation, or fails to begin construction or renovation within 1 year.
-
Mandates a development agreement between the Michigan Strategic Fund and entrepreneurial business facilities that includes compliance with state and local laws, annual reporting on capital investment, employment numbers, and raw materials purchased in-state, and business plan approval by a state-recognized entrepreneurial support resource.
-
Establishes criteria for board consideration when designating zones, including economic impact on local suppliers, job creation relative to community employment base, project viability, and community economic impact.
Legislative Description
Economic development; renaissance zones; entrepreneurial renaissance zones (e-zones); create. Amends sec. 3 of 1996 PA 376 (MCL 125.2683) & adds sec. 8i.
